Touring cycling in Valkenhorst offers a network of routes through a natural park characterized by extensive heathlands, dense forests, and open fields. The terrain is generally flat to gently undulating, with minimal elevation changes, making it suitable for various cycling abilities. These landscapes provide a tranquil setting for exploring the region's natural beauty on two wheels. The area features well-maintained asphalt and gravel paths, connecting different natural reserves.

On September 20, 1944, around 4 p.m., Antoon cycled from the now-liberated Geldrop toward Budel, which was about to be liberated. He rode home via Heeze, Leende, and Soerendonk, carrying a briefcase on a black women's bicycle. Past Leende, he passed fellow villager Jan Lammers, who had been milking a cow as a farmhand for the Van Lievenoogen family and was then returning to the farm with a jug of milk. Antoon asked him if Budel had been liberated yet. Jan didn't dare say, but it could happen at any moment, as the area was teeming with retreating German soldiers and gunfire could be heard clearly in the distance. At that moment, five SS men or German soldiers jumped onto the road and stopped Jan and Antoon. They were asked to show their identity cards. Jan didn't have any, but Antoon handed over his forged one. His bag was also searched. Suddenly, Antoon is cursed and labeled a traitor. "We're going to kill you!" is shouted at him. Antoon collapses and begs for mercy, while Jan is ordered to run away. He has to watch as Antoon is shot and bayoneted to death on the roadside. Antoon was 31 years old.

Valkenhorst offers a wide selection of touring cycling routes, with over 890 routes available on komoot. This extensive network provides options for various ability levels, from easy loops to moderate long-distance routes through heathlands, forests, and tranquil natural park settings.
The terrain in Valkenhorst is generally flat to gently undulating, with minimal elevation changes. This makes it suitable for a wide range of cycling abilities. Routes traverse extensive heathlands, dense forests, and open fields, primarily on well-maintained asphalt and gravel paths.
Yes, Valkenhorst has a significant number of easy touring cycling routes, with nearly 600 options available. A great choice for an easy ride is the Heather Field – Asphalt paths through the forest loop from Leende, which is 22.1 km long and guides cyclists through serene heather fields and shaded forest paths.
The komoot community highly rates touring cycling in Valkenhorst, with an average score of 4.38 stars from over 1800 reviews. Cyclists often praise the tranquil natural park settings, the well-maintained paths, and the diverse landscapes of heathlands and forests that define the region.
While the terrain is generally gentle, there are moderate routes for those seeking longer distances. For example, the Great Crane Fen – Achelse Kluis Border Lane loop from Leende is a moderate 64.8 km route that offers a longer exploration of the region's natural beauty.
Absolutely. The heathlands are a defining feature of Valkenhorst. You can explore them on routes like the Valkenhorst Heath – Lieropsche Heath Gravel Path loop from Leende, which traverses the open landscapes of Valkenhorst Heath and Lieropsche Heath on gravel paths. Another option is the Strabrechtse Heath – View of the Strabrechtse Ven loop from Leende, leading through expansive heathlands.
Along the touring cycling routes in Valkenhorst, you can discover various natural attractions. Highlights include the expansive Valkenhorst Heath, the serene Valkenhorst Nature Reserve, and the picturesque Valkenhorst Heath and Pond. Many routes also feature scenic cycle paths through dense forests.
Yes, many of the touring cycling routes in Valkenhorst are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the Heather Field – Asphalt paths through the forest loop from Leende and the Asphalt paths through the forest – 't Nupke Mill loop from Leende.
The routes in Valkenhorst feature a mix of well-maintained asphalt and gravel paths. This variety ensures a pleasant cycling experience through different natural settings, from smooth forest roads to more rustic heathland trails.
Yes, Valkenhorst's touring cycling routes are known for their combination of landscapes. Many routes guide you through dense forests and then open up to expansive heathlands and fields, offering a varied and scenic experience. The Asphalt paths through the forest – 't Nupke Mill loop from Leende is a good example, showcasing both forest paths and open areas.
